Vining Watermelon Day 

   

“The Biggest Small Town Celebration in Otter Tail County”

 

The third Saturday of each August finds our town buzzing with activity as we celebrate our annual Watermelon Day Event!  This tradition was started in 1972.  Vining will be celebrating the 30th anniversary of Vining Watermelon Day on August 17, 2002. 

Between 70 and 100 Arts and Craft vendors arrive to sell their wares.  Popular food items are available all day from vendors and local groups.  Watermelon is served free!  Other activities include:  special musical entertainment, children’s games, a Petting Zoo for children, Bingo, at 7:00 p.m. parade and a dance in the evening.

The population of Vining is small, but folks in the surrounding area and lakes volunteer and help make the events of the day possible as Vining will host from 3,000 to 4,000 people for the day.  The Watermelon Day Committee, the Area Booster Supporters and all the workers are proud to be able to continue this fantastic tradition.  We’re happy to welcome so many folks to our town for this event.
